Military exposure

Many veterans served during a time in which asbestos was widely used. The toxic material was used in military bases, aircraft, ships, and vehicles. Unfortunately, these companies were aware about the health risks associated with their products, but they concealed this information from the military to increase profits. The people and women who used these products were unaware of the dangers until they developed asbestos-related diseases like mesothelioma a few decades afterward.

The military relied on Asbestos because it was durable and fire-resistant. It was used for insulation as well as in the manufacture of vehicles and ships, and even clothing. Asbestos was found in many military facilities including Army bases, Navy yard and Coast Guard vessels. These asbestos-related diseases affect all branches of the military, but veterans in the Army are at a higher risk.

For most of its time the United States Army relied heavily on asbestos-based products. Army servicemen and women that worked in boiler rooms or engine areas were exposed to the dangerous material. The Air Force also used many asbestos-based products. Pilots, mechanics and other personnel who worked in the cockpit of aircrafts were also at risk for exposure.

Since mesothelioma symptoms usually do not show up until 20-50 years after exposure, many veterans have been diagnosed with the disease. Veterans Affairs might be able provide benefits for the affected women and men. These benefits may cover treatment costs for mesothelioma and other ailments.

A VA disability claim may aid veterans in gaining access to the most reputable mesothelioma experts in the world. It also helps to pay for living expenses and other costs related to mesothelioma. However the VA claim is not an alternative to a personal injury lawsuit against the asbestos companies that caused the exposure.

Bankruptcy

Companies that expose their employees to asbestos in a reckless and unknowingly manner can be held responsible for their actions. Some of these companies filed bankruptcy to avoid liability for their actions. The bankruptcy of a company can stop any lawsuits pending. However, victims can still claim trust fund compensation from the bankrupt company. These funds are created during the bankruptcy process to compensate mesothelioma sufferers.
